During the time of the Battle of the Atlantic all Canadian Flower Class Corvettes were named after cities, towns, and villages (HMCS ALBERNI, HMCS SACKSVILLE, HMCS CHARLOTTETOWN) to distinguish them from British Flower Class Corvettes which were named after flowers (hence the term "flower class"). Canadian ships were (are) 'HMCS' while British ships were (are) HMS. The Canadian Corvette K136 in this film would have been HMCS SHAWINIGAN for historical accuracy.
